Need something to bring to a picnic? How about homemade cole slaw?

It's almost picnic season. I love, love, LOVE cole slaw but have never attempted to make it myself. That is, until I found this recipe. Guess it's time to give it a shot.
8 C finely diced cabbage (about 1 head)
1⁄4 C diced carrot
2 Tbsp. minced onions
1⁄3 C granulated sugar
1⁄2 tsp. salt
1⁄8 tsp. pepper
1⁄4 C milk
1⁄2 C mayonnaise
1⁄4 C buttermilk
1-1⁄2 Tbsp. white vinegar
2 1⁄2 Tbsp. lemon juice
Finely dice the cabbage and carrots (easiest way to do this would be using the fine shredder disc on a food processor.) Pour cabbage and carrot mixture into large bowl and stir in minced onions.
Using the regular blade on a food processor, process remaining ingredients until smooth. Pour over cabbage mixture and mix thoroughly.
Cover bowl and refrigerate several hours or overnight before serving.
NOTE: I've been told that you can substitute a bag of cole slaw mix from the produce section for the cabbage and carrots and get the same results. This cole slaw is supposed to be very much like the stuff from KFC.
